    The maximun back pressure of a reciprocating CHP engine exhaust gas is 400 mmWG. To calculate the pressure drop of the whole exhaust system, I have taken into account: elbows,straight sections, dampers, diverter,tee, branches, silencers, heat exchanger, gradual expansion, free discharge.
